Mel's Mix at Lowes
There is a topic here titled "Suitable location for teaching." Buried in that thread is the best news I have heard yet!
Lowes will be carrying Mel's Mix. The bad news is that not every Lowes will have it. Go online to www.lowes.com and search for "squarefootgardeningsoil". Then put in your ZIP code and they will tell you if it is available near you.
My local Lowes does not carry it. I talked to Customer Service at Lowes headquarters. Someone from the local Lowes called me back. I peaded. He explained that the buyers often make deals with suppliers -- he gave me Miracle Grow as an example -- that a district will carry only their stuff. I pleaded some more. I explained the growing search for this product.
He is going to talk to the buyer and search surrounding states to see if any other district has it.
Let's get a campaign going... Here's Lowes Customer Service Number: 1-800-445-6937
Here's the item number: #308781
Let's let them know where the market is.
Addendum: just got another call back from Marty at Lowes. BooHoo. The closest store that carries it is in TEXAS!!!! Good news for Texans. Pass the word.

Re: Mel's Mix at Lowes
In another life, I worked for a major supplier to Lowe's.
You SHOULD be able to get it through their special order department. It may take a long time, though, as they work transfers from stores who stock it to stores who don't stock it...which means it's hauled backward through the system, which is as traumatic as it sounds.
If the store manager doesn't give you an answer, talk to the special order desk. Give them the item number and description (the screen grab would be excellent if printed off and given to them!) -- then see what they say.

Re: Mel's Mix at Lowes
Patience, too, folks -- remember that Lowe's has 1,700 stores in the US, Canada, and Mexico, and the logistics of supplying even just one pallet to each store is *enormous*.
It takes a long time for a new vendor to get through the system...and just to put it into perspective, if you count one pallet per store (and most stores will want to stock at least 3 pallets) -- that's still 1,700 pallets of Mel's Mix...and that works out to be somewhere in the neighbourhood of 63 fully-loaded semi trucks.
That's a lot for any manufacturer to produce, and a lot for anybody to distribute. It's pretty common for a new product rollout to go on a region by region basis, because it's easier for Lowe's, the trucking companies, and the manufacturers to handle it.
So be patient...it can't physically happen overnight.
If your local store doesn't have it right now, it doesn't mean that they don't want to carry it...it just might not be ready for their region yet.
